(Representational Image)In a bid to meet the increasing power consumption and save costs, the Surat Municipal Corporation (SMC) is set to come up with three solar power projects of 10 megawatts (MW) each this year. During his Gujarat visit, PM Narendra Modi will Thursday virtually inaugurate the Patan project and lay the foundation stone of another project in Banaskantha.
Additional city engineer of SMC Ashish Naik said, “ With this move, we will increase solar energy generation and reach a mark of 34 per cent… but we have set a target to reach 40 per cent.”

Meanwhile, the Surat civic body has installed solar panels on the rooftop of different properties that it owns in 30 different locations, including health centres. The project – worth Rs. 13.15 crores – aims to generate 2.62 GW of power per year. PM Modi will also inaugurate this project on Thursday.
